Overview

This book contains a detailed study of the most popular summability methods and their applications, in particular, in Wijsman statistical and invariant convergence for double sequences of sets using modulus function. It is intended as a reference book for further work and research on Wijsman convergence in higher-dimensional sequence spaces. It can also be used for seminar work and master's and Ph.D. theses. The book is self-contained and comprehensive. It also provides the basic tools for researchers using directly or indirectly the notion of sequences and series and their convergence problems using modern summability methods. This book is intended for graduate students and researchers who have an interest in sequence spaces, summability methods and their applications, functional analysis in particular, and summability theory in general.
